Key Stories Impacting Rigel Pharmaceuticals
Here are the key news stories impacting Rigel Pharmaceuticals this week:
- Positive Sentiment: Revenue and profitability exceeded expectations. Rigel reported second-quarter revenue of $78.7 million, including $67.0 million in product sales and $11.7 million in collaboration revenue. Net income was $17.3 million, or $0.88 per share. Revenue substantially exceeded consensus estimates near $55 million, while the EPS result beat some published estimates, including MarketBeat’s $0.09 forecast. Rigel Reports Second Quarter 2026 Financial Results
- Positive Sentiment: Full-year revenue guidance was raised or set above consensus. Rigel expects 2026 total revenue of approximately $285 million to $295 million, compared with analyst expectations of roughly $277 million. The outlook includes $255 million to $265 million in product sales, excluding VEPPANU, and about $30 million in collaboration revenue. Rigel Pharmaceuticals earnings and guidance
- Positive Sentiment: Portfolio expansion could add a new commercial growth driver. Rigel in-licensed VEPPANU (vepdegestrant), with U.S. commercial availability expected in mid-August. The company also said its R289 Phase 1b study in lower-risk myelodysplastic syndromes remains on track to complete dose-expansion enrollment and select a Phase 2 dose during the second half of 2026. Rigel Pharmaceuticals Profile
Rigel Pharmaceuticals, Inc is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company headquartered in South San Francisco, California. Founded in 2003, Rigel focuses on the discovery, development and commercialization of novel small molecule therapeutics targeting immune, hematologic and oncologic diseases. Leveraging a proprietary chemistry platform and expertise in signal transduction pathways, the company aims to address significant unmet medical needs in both rare and common disorders.
Rigel’s lead product, fostamatinib (commercially known as Tavalisse®), is an oral spleen tyrosine kinase (SYK) inhibitor approved in the United States for the treatment of adult patients with chronic immune thrombocytopenia (ITP).
